Sliding Windows Installation in Framingham, MA
Sliding windows installation services involve replacing or installing horizontal sash windows that slide open and close along a track. These windows are popular for their ease of use, space-saving design, and ability to provide ample natural light and ventilation. Projects typically include upgrading existing windows for improved energy efficiency, replacing old or damaged units, or installing new sliding windows in additions or renovations. Property owners often want to understand the different frame materials available, such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ood, as well as the options for glazing and hardware to ensure the windows meet their aesthetic and functional needs.
Before requesting sliding window installation services, homeowners should consider the size and style of windows that best suit their property’s architecture and their personal preferences. It’s helpful to evaluate the window placement for optimal light and airflow, as well as to clarify any requirements related to energy efficiency or security features. Understanding the scope of the project, including whether existing frames need removal or modification, can also assist in planning the installation process effectively.

Sliding Windows Installation Questions
What are the benefits of sliding windows? Sliding windows offer easy operation, unobstructed views, and space-saving design suitable for various home styles.
Can sliding windows be customized to match existing home styles? Yes, they are available in different materials, finishes, and sizes to complement different architectural designs.
Are sliding windows energy-efficient? Many sliding windows include features like double glazing and weather stripping to help improve energy efficiency.
What types of projects typically involve sliding window installation? They are often used in renovations, new construction, or replacing older, less functional window styles.
